With the arrangement of Wayne Shorter's Infant Eves, I officially start the series dedicated to the most typical orchestral ensemble in jazz: the Big Band.
The instrumentation is the traditional one: 5 saxophones, 4 trumpets, 4 trombones and rhythm section (guitar, piano, double bass and drums).
After a brief introduction, in which the double bass moves freely over an orchestral accompaniment, the exposition of the initial part of theme A is entrusted to the first trombone, followed by the saxophone section and then the trumpet section (B).
This all flows into the last section of the theme (C), in a robust brass ensemble to which the saxophones respond with simple counterpoint phrases.
The last four bars, again entrusted to the saxophones, gradually lead us to the solo section.
The latter is developed over a chorus and a half, and each of the soloists is given one of the four sections (A, B, C, A): the first is by the first trombone (the arrangement's main soloist), the second by the first alto saxophone, while the third features the orchestra in a short nine-bar special, where the three sections chase and chase each other.
The final solo part is then entrusted to the second trumpet, which gives way to the orchestra for the reprise of the remaining two sections of the theme as well as the inevitable coda.
Altogether, the arrangement spans three complete choruses, plus the introduction and coda, for a total duration of just under seven minutes.
